Press release from St. Louis Science Center: November 18, 2021 A partial lunar eclipse will be visible tonight starting just after midnight. The eclipse begins 12:02 am and ends at 6:03 am on November 19, 2021. The partial stages of the eclipse begin at 1:18 am as the Moon begins to enter Earth's umbral shadow. The Moon will leave the umbral shadow at 4:47 am ending the partial eclipse. Maximum eclipse occurs at 3:02 am when roughly 97% of the Moon will appear eclipsed. Learn more here.
